93, of Indianapolis passed away on February 12, 2012. He was born on January 22, 1919 in Fort Jennings, Ohio to William and Emma Millenbaugh Ostendorf. Paul served in the U.S. Army as a Sargent during WWII with the Normandy, Northern France, Rhineland and Central Europe campaigns. He worked as a conductor for the Pennsylvania Railroad, retiring in 1981. He was a member of Holy Spirit Catholic Church. Paul is the widower of Vivian T. Rahrig Ostendorf.
